Definition
The term “fair go” originated from Australian culture, particularly in sports like rugby and cricket. It roughly translates to giving someone a fair chance or an equal opportunity to succeed or participate. Over time, the concept has been adopted by other sectors as well, incorporating it into their practices and policies.
In gaming, for example, fair go is used to describe games or platforms that adhere to principles such as transparency in rules, randomness of outcomes, and fairness in rewards distribution. This ensures players have a level playing field and can enjoy the experience without worrying about manipulation or favoritism.
